Established in 1946, NIE Mysore is one of the well-known institutes in the southern region of India. The institute provides courses in a vast selection of disciplines and specializations. The institute has prominently 2 separate campuses, for the convenience of distributing courses to students. The North Campus provides access to courses like Computer Science, Computer Science (AI & ML), MCA,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ics.On the other hand, the NIE Mysore South Campus offers courses in Electrical & Electronics, Mechanical, Electronics & Communication, Civil, Mathematics, and Physics.

The fees for the BE programme at the National Institute of Engineering, Mysore, is different for different categories of admission. For government quota under KCET, the fees are around INR 1 to 1.5 Lacs per year; for COMED-K quota, it is around INR 2 to 2.5 Lacs per year; for management quota, though it is higher. The fees perhaps also vary depending upon the branch. Other possible costs may include hostel fee, examination fee, etc. All the very best.

Are there any government job opportunities that I can seek after completing BE from NIE Mysore?

Once you are done with BE from NIE Mysore, you can look out for various government jobs based on your specialisation and interest. These generally consist of PSUs such as BHEL, IOCL, ONGC and NTPC, which hire people based on GATE exams, UPSC ESE for central government jobs, ISRO DRDO and SSC JE, state government engineering services and railways through the RRB JE and SSE and banking sector specialist officer exams in IBPS and SBI, CDS and AFCAT for defense services. You can also enter teaching positions in government colleges via SET or NET ranks. All the best.

NIE Mysore has released the BE cutoffs for the year 2024. As per the latest available data, the closing rank cutoff for the General-All India based on KCET scores ranged from 12747 to 103761. Moreover, the BE course with the highest competition was Electronics and Communication Engineering. Earlier, in 2023, the cutoff for the same category of students ranged from 9018 to 82211.
